| Abstract | The battle of Salamis can be considered a ‘miracle’ in three respects. There is the ‘David and Goliath’ kind of miracle that a much smaller Greek fleet manages to defeat the Persian opponent. There is the miracle that the Greeks offer battle at all, after their endless debates. But the biggest miracle is Artemisia, called a literal θαῦμα by Herodotus himself. My close-reading of her bravura martial feat, which makes her even more esteemed in Xerxes’ eyes, shows why for Herodotus such events are quintessentially historical stuff, more than exact numbers or military strategies. |
